ABSTRACT
Transurethral removal of bladder or urethral stones in children is not easy and open removal of the stone is required in many cases because the urethra in a child is narrow and adequate equipment is not available. In a 6-year old boy with multiple urinary stones who had underwent vesicolithotomy twice before, we tried percutaneous removal of the bladder stones using suprapubic trocar and adult cystourethroscope set. Nelaton catheter was used as a guide wire in Seldinger technique while switching the instruments through the suprapubic cystostomy tract. With the same technique we removed a urethral stone in a 5-year boy successfully."
